The land inside the red lines has been rezoned from rural to business land.
Rolleston’s industrial hub is set to expand westward as a huge chunk of land has been rezoned at the request of property developers the Carter Group.
Selwyn district councillors last week decided to rezone 98 hectares of rural land bordered by Two Chain Rd, the existing industrial area, State Highway 1, and Walkers Rd.
An independent commissioner said the rezoning would have “significant economic benefits” and recommended that councillors approve it.
Carter Group’s Tim Carter said Rolleston was “a key industrial hub” for the South Island and the land was “a logical extension” of the existing industrial area.
